Step-by-step

  • Spray or grease an 8 x 8 or 9 x 9 inch pan. Set aside.
  • Place evaporated milk, sugar and butter in a large, deep saucepan. Bring to boil over medium heat, stirring constantly.
  • When mixture begins to boil, reduce heat to medium-low and cook for 10 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  • Mixture will foam and rise…you need a DEEP saucepan as the volume will double when boiling…this is important!!!
  • Add the flour, chocolate chips, walnuts and graham cracker crumbs. Stir until well combined.
  • Pour in prepared pan and let cool. Pan may also be placed in the refrigerator to speed the cooling process (about 30 minutes in refrigerator).
  • Cut into 9 bars when cool. Serves 9

Ingredients:

  • 2 cups sugar
  • 1 cup chopped walnuts
  • 1 cup evaporated milk
  • 1 cup graham cracker crumbs
  • 1 cup chocolate chips
  • 3/4 cup flour
  • 1/2 cup butter (or a combination of butter and coconut oil)
